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Baltimore, MD, USA and Roswell, NM, USA?

American Airlines, United Airlines, and Southwest Airlines fly from Baltimore-Washington International Airport (BWI) to Roswell Industrial Air Center Airport (ROW) 3 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Baltimore Downtown Bus Station to Roswell Pecos Trails Transit via Harrisburg Bus Station, St Louis Bus Station, and Amarillo Multimodal Transfer Sta in around 42h 20m.
